当前位置:首页 » 网络连接 » 计算机网络报文偏移值
扩展阅读
公共无线网络登录 2025-09-29 18:26:20

计算机网络报文偏移值

发布时间: 2023-04-18 21:13:26

计算机网络通信中为什么要在数据封装时加上报头,有什么作用

简单说,IPV4报头是把上一层的数据加上了源IP地址和目标IP地址,详见如下

IPV4报头有12个必需的字段和可选IP选项字段,位于要发送的数据之前。如果使用IP层已有的库或其他组件,一般不必考虑报头中的大多数字段,但程序代码需要提供源端和目的端地址。
1、版本(4比特)
IP协议版本已经经过多次修订,1981年的RFC0791描述了IPV4,RCF2460中介绍了IPV6。
2、报头长度(4比特)
报头长度是报头数据的扒如长度,以4字节表示,也就是以32字节为单位。报头长度是可变的。必需的字段使用20字节(报头长度为5,IP选项字段最多有40个附加字节(报头长度为15)。
3、服务类型(8比特)
该字段给出发送进程建议路由器如何处理报片的方法。可选择最大可靠性、最小延迟、最大吞吐量和最小开销。路由器可以忽略这部分。
4、数据报长度(16比特)
该字段是报头长度和数据字节的总和,以字节为单位。最大长度为65535字节。
5、标识符(16比特)
原是数据的主机为数据报分配一个唯一的数据报标识符。在数据报传向目的地址时,如果路由器将数据报分为报片,那么每个报片都有相同的数据标识符。
6、标志(3比特)
标志字段中有2为与报片有关。
位0:未用。
位1:不是报片。如果这位是1,则路由器就不会把数据报分片。路由器会尽可能把数据报传给可一次接收整个数据报的网络;否则,路由器会放弃数据报,并返回差错报文,表示目的地址不可达。IP标准要求主机可以接收576字节以内的数据报,因此,如果想把数据报传给未知的主机,并想确认数据报没有因为大小的原因而被放弃,那么就使用少于或等于576字节的数据。
位2:更多的报片。如果该位为1,则数据报是一个报片,但不是该分片数据报的最后一个报片;如果该位为0,则数据报没有分片,或者是最后一个报片。
7、报片偏移(13比特)
该字段标识报片在分片数据报中的位置。其值以8字节为单位,最大为8191字节,对应65528字节的偏移。
例如,将要发送的1024字节分为576和424字节两个报片。首片的偏移是0,第二片的偏移是72(因为72×8=576)。
8、生存时间(8比特)
如果数据报在合理时间内没有到达目的地,则网络就会放弃它。生存时间字段确定放弃数据报的时间。
生存时间表示数据报剩余的时间,每个路由器都会将其值减一,或递减需要数理和传递数据报的时间。实际上,路由器处理和传递数据报的时间一般都小于1S,因此该值绝虚没有测量时间,而是测量路由器之间跳跃次数或网段的个数。发送数据报的计算机设置初始生存时间。
9、协议(8比特)
该字段指定数据报的数据部并此燃分所使用的协议,因此IP层知道将接收到的数据报传向何处。TCP协议为6,UDP协议为17。
10、报头检验和(16比特)
该字端使数据报的接收方只需要检验IP报头中的错误,而不校验数据区的内容或报文。校验和由报头中的数值计算而得,报头校验和假设为0,以太网帧和TCP报文段以及UDP数据报中的可选项都需要进行报文检错。
11、源IP地址(32比特)
表示数据报的发送方。
12、目的IP地址(32比特)
表示数据报的目的地。

② 计算机原理中偏移值怎么

计算机原理中偏移值的计算分为“加法”和“减法”两种方式。
计算机汇编语言中的偏移量定义为:把存储单元的实际地址与其所在段的段地址之间的距离称为段内偏移,也称为“有效地址或偏移量”。“偏移量是人工加密方式的一种解析手段,没有更改过默认偏移量的清机加钞员将无法在ATM上获取开锁密码;每个清机加钞员获得的密码为4组,每组2位数字。

③ 传输层报文传输时若分片,偏移量用除以8吗

用,IP报偏移的单位是8字节

④ 在报表处理子系统中,关键字偏移量单位为

在报表处理子系统中,关键字偏移量单位为象素。在报表处理子系统中,关键字的位置可以用偏移量来表示。报表处理子系统的主要作用是帮助用户及时、方便地编制需要的各种会计报表。在各类财务报表中,每个数据都有明确的经济含义,并且数据间往往存在着某种对应关系,称为勾稽关系,会计信息系统中的报表处理子系统一般是一个四维立体报表处理系统,要确定一个数据的所有要素为:表名、表页、列和行。
拓展资料:
1、像素是计算机屏幕上所能显示的最小单位。用来表示图像的单位。在非学术性媒体中,亦通俗作“象素”。首先我们要明确一点,一张数码照片的实际像素值跟感应器的象素值是有所不同的。以一般的感应器为例,每个像素带有一个光电二极管,代表着照片中的一个像素。例如一部拥有500万像素的数码相亏握机,它的感应器能输出分辨率为 2,560 x 1,920的图像—其实精确来讲,这个数值只相等于490万有效像素。
2、像素是指由图像的小方格组成的,这些小方块都有一个明确的位置和被分配的色彩数值,小方格颜色和位置就决定该图像所呈现出来的样子。可以将像素视为整个图像中不可分割的单位或者是元素。不可分割的意思是它不能够再切割成更小单位抑或是元素,它是以一个单一颜色的小格存在,每一个点阵图像包含了一定量的像素销差庆,这些像素决定图像在屏幕上所呈现的大小。
3、报表处理子系统中,编制单位、日期一般不作为文字内容输入,而是需要设置为关键字。在定义报表单元属性中,数庆冲值单元输入后只对本表页有效。随着计算机网络技术的发展和普及,不少报表系统为了满足用户在网络间报表数据传输的需求,都将远程通讯功能作为系统的基本功能。

⑤ 求解计算机网络,ip数据报里的offset可以是小数吗例如380/8

IP数据包里的OFFSET应该是分组偏移量,以8字节为单位,不能是小数。另外380/8=47也不是小数啊

⑥ 计算机网络方面的计算机题,请帮忙回答,关于数据报的

题意不是很清楚.从“数据报”这一名词,我推测你说的是IP层。

显然,IP层的固定首部为20个字节:
所以要发送的信息数据长度为:5000-20=4800(字节)
分片为:4800/1600=3(^_^,太巧合了);
所以各数据片的数据长度为:1600字节;

下面说说片偏移
首先你要明白片偏移是以8个字节为单位的。
所以第一片的片偏移为:0;
第二片为:1600/8=200;
第三片为:1600/8+200=400;

最后说说MF标志:
MF全称为more fragment,意思为还有分片吗?
显然有三个分片,所以MF分别为:
1,1,0。

最后给你补一点小知识:
IP首部还有一个叫DF的字段,该字段全称为:don't fragment,意思是不能分片。如果该字段为一,数据报就不会分片,如果出现题目超最大长度的现象,则返回的是ICMP差错报告报文;显然此题中数据报DF字段为0,才能出现以上我讨论的情况。

^_^,给分我吧。

⑦ IP报文格式中 位偏移字段一共13比特位 那这13比特位每一比特对应的含义是是么

IP包结构

IP协议
IP包结构为IP协议头+有效载荷,包括IP协议首部的分析,分析的IP分组的主要内容时,IP数据包的详细信息,请参阅有关的相关信息。这里显示的IP协议头的结构。
版本:4 -
的IPv4报头长度:4字节为单位,最多60个字节
TOS:IP优先级字段
总长度:单位字节,最大65535字节
标识:IP报文标识符现场
标志:占3位,使用
MF(更多片段)
MF = 1,只有低阶2位,并态芹有碎片包
MF = 0,最后一个 BR> DF(不分片)分片报文
DF = 1,不允许分片
DF = 0,使碎片
段偏移:当数据包分片的原始数据包的相对位置,共有13位,8个字节
生活单位:TTL(生衡闭缺存时间)丢弃数据包的TTL = 0
协议:什么样的协议进行数据包我们咐辩1:ICMP页6:TCP BR> 17:UDP
89:OSPF
头检验和:中华人民共和国IP协议进行检查第一和太平洋源IP地址的报文的IP
源地址和目的IP地址:IP数据包的目的地地址

⑧ 计算机网络中IP数据报的片偏移计算

答案是A,偏移量的意思就是这个数据包是从源数据包哪个地方开始的,因为IP报文有40个字节的IP报文头,所以1300个字节的数据会被分成以下三个包: A数据包:包含40个字节的IP报文头,0-460字节的数据,偏移量为0; B数据包:包含40个字节的IP报文头,460-920字节的数据,偏移量为460; C数据包:包含40个字节的IP报文头,920-1300字节的数据,偏移量为920

⑨ 计算机网络偏移量怎么算

举例说明:考虑发送一个1300字节的数据报到MTU为 500字节的链路中(B)。 • A、产生三个分片,偏移量为0,460,920 • B、产生三个分片,偏移量为0,60,120 • C、产生三个分片,偏移量为0,500,1000 • D、以上答案都不正确。

答案是A:偏移量的意思就是这个数据包是从源数据包哪个地方开始的,因为IP报文有40个字节的IP报文头,所以1300个字节的数据会被分成以下三个包:
A数据包:包含40个字节的IP报文头,0-460字节的数据,偏移量为0;
B数据包:包含40个字节的IP报文头,460-920字节的数据,偏移量为460;
C数据包:包含40个字节的IP报文头,920-1300字节的数据,偏移量为920